The Significance of Coronas De Flores
In Mexican culture, coronas de flores are a way to honor the deceased and celebrate their life, with different colors and flowers holding specific meanings. For example, white lilies represent purity and innocence, while red roses symbolize love and passion. By choosing the right flowers, families can create a meaningful and personalized tribute to their loved one.
Practical Tips for Creating a Beautiful Corona
To create a stunning corona de flores, start with a wire base or a flower crown frame, and then add your chosen flowers and greenery. Consider using a mix of textures and colors to add depth and visual interest to the arrangement. Don't be afraid to get creative and add personal touches, such as ribbons or photos, to make the corona truly unique.
